MONTEIRO, Silvio; RECHE, Maurício  and  DE ASSIS, Altair S. UNDESIRED SPLASH OVER ON EQUIPMENTS USING INDUCTIVE SENSORS FOR MONITORING AUTOMOTIVE VEHICLES' CONTROLLED SPEED. Rev.EIA.Esc.Ing.Antioq [online]. 2017, n.27, pp.97-109. ISSN 1794-1237.

This article aims to evaluate instruments that oversight traffic flow electronically, using inductive surface sensors, based on the change of local magnetic field. More specifically, we study the possibility of false speed detections, due to the manifestation of the phenomenon called splash over - which means a space splash of the magnetic field lines out of the measuring zone. We show, through the literature, and practical simulations, the damage that can be caused by splash on the correct speed measurement and identification of the car under suspicions. It is also presented solutions to inhibiting unwanted velocity measurements due to this effect.

Keywords : Oversight Traffic; Speed Meters; Legal Metrology; Splash Over; Magnetic Field.
